Industrial Certifications, Partnerships & Work Keys, All Part of the Workforce System
SPENCER - The Lakes Area Employers’ Council (ECI) will be meeting on Wednesday, January 16, 2008 at 9:00 a.m. at Iowa Lakes Community College, 1900 N. Grand Ave., in Spencer, Iowa. All employers, human resource personnel, accounting, payroll, and other staff members are invited to attend. Featured speakers will be Dr. Harold Prior, President of Iowa Lakes Community College and Linda Glorfield of Iowa Workforce Development.
Dr. Harold Prior will be talking about the unique partnerships and programs that Iowa Lakes Community College offers, as well as, other industrial certifications that I.L.C.C. currently offers or may offer in the future.

Dr. Harold D. Prior is currently President of Iowa Lakes Community College. His previous educational experience included serving as Superintendent of the Algona Community School District from 1988 until 2006, Superintendent of the Burt Community School District from 1991 until 2001 and Superintendent of the West Bend School District from 1983 until 1988. He also worked as a Principal, a Secondary Teacher and as a Coach in Bedford. Dr. Prior was named Superintendent of the year in 1999-2000 by the School Administrators of Iowa. Dr. Prior’s educational credentials include a Bachelor’s Degree in Education from Peru State College, a Master’s Degree from Northwest Missouri State University and a Ph.D. in Educational Administration from Iowa State University in 1991. He is a veteran of the U.S. Air Force where he served as a nuclear weapons specialist.

The Lakes Area Employers’ Council is a local employer group supported by Iowa Workforce Development Region 3 and 4, and is part of the statewide Employers’ Council of Iowa system. This employer’s group addresses workforce issues, and provides both educational and networking opportunities for employers and human resource professionals. Contact Bob Becker at
